Is annulment free?

No, annulment is not free. There are usually filing fees associated with the annulment process, and you may also need to hire an attorney, which can be costly. The specific costs can vary depending on your location and individual circumstances.

How much does an annulment cost in TN?

The cost of obtaining an annulment in Tennessee can vary significantly depending on factors such as attorney fees and court costs. Generally, attorney fees can range from $1,000 to $3,000, while court filing fees are typically around $200. Additional costs may arise from required documentation or specific circumstances of the case. It's advisable to consult with a legal expert for a more accurate estimate based on individual situations.
